POST api/UpdateZoneCheckList
Request Information
URI Parameters
None.
Body Parameters
ImportZoneCheckListRequest| Name | Description | Type | Additional information |
|---|---|---|---|
| UserEmail | string |
None. |
|
| CheckListID | integer |
None. |
|
| CheckListName | string |
None. |
|
| ProjectTypeID | string |
None. |
|
| Status | string |
None. |
|
| ProjectList | Collection of CreateZoneCheckListProjectListModel |
None. |
|
| JobTypeList | Collection of CreateZoneCheckListJobTypeListModel |
None. |
Request Formats
application/json, text/json
Sample:
{
"UserEmail": "sample string 1",
"CheckListID": 2,
"CheckListName": "sample string 3",
"ProjectTypeID": "sample string 4",
"Status": "sample string 5",
"ProjectList": [
{
"ProjectCode": "sample string 1",
"Selected": "sample string 2"
},
{
"ProjectCode": "sample string 1",
"Selected": "sample string 2"
}
],
"JobTypeList": [
{
"JobTypeID": 1,
"JobTypeName": "sample string 2",
"ZoneTypeID": 3,
"LocationList": [
{
"LocationID": 1,
"LocationName": "sample string 2"
},
{
"LocationID": 1,
"LocationName": "sample string 2"
}
],
"SubJobTypeList": [
{
"SubJobTypeID": 1,
"SubJobTypeName": "sample string 2",
"DetailList": [
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
},
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
}
]
},
{
"SubJobTypeID": 1,
"SubJobTypeName": "sample string 2",
"DetailList": [
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
},
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
}
]
}
]
},
{
"JobTypeID": 1,
"JobTypeName": "sample string 2",
"ZoneTypeID": 3,
"LocationList": [
{
"LocationID": 1,
"LocationName": "sample string 2"
},
{
"LocationID": 1,
"LocationName": "sample string 2"
}
],
"SubJobTypeList": [
{
"SubJobTypeID": 1,
"SubJobTypeName": "sample string 2",
"DetailList": [
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
},
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
}
]
},
{
"SubJobTypeID": 1,
"SubJobTypeName": "sample string 2",
"DetailList": [
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
},
{
"DetailID": 1,
"DetailName": "sample string 2",
"IsRequired": true,
"IsSupplier": true
}
]
}
]
}
]
}
application/xml, text/xml
Sample:
<ImportZoneCheckListR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/Sirius_Api.Models.Sirius">
<CheckListID>2</CheckListID>
<CheckListName>sample string 3</CheckListName>
<JobTypeList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el>
<JobTypeID>1</JobTypeID>
<JobTypeName>sample string 2</JobTypeName>
<LocationList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
<LocationID>1</LocationID>
<LocationName>sample string 2</LocationName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
<LocationID>1</LocationID>
<LocationName>sample string 2</LocationName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
</LocationList>
<SubJobTypeList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
<DetailList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
</DetailList>
<SubJobTypeID>1</SubJobTypeID>
<SubJobTypeName>sample string 2</SubJobTypeName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
<DetailList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
</DetailList>
<SubJobTypeID>1</SubJobTypeID>
<SubJobTypeName>sample string 2</SubJobTypeName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
</SubJobTypeList>
<ZoneTypeID>3</ZoneTypeID>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el>
<JobTypeID>1</JobTypeID>
<JobTypeName>sample string 2</JobTypeName>
<LocationList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
<LocationID>1</LocationID>
<LocationName>sample string 2</LocationName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
<LocationID>1</LocationID>
<LocationName>sample string 2</LocationName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ListLocationListModel>
</LocationList>
<SubJobTypeList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
<DetailList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
</DetailList>
<SubJobTypeID>1</SubJobTypeID>
<SubJobTypeName>sample string 2</SubJobTypeName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
<DetailList>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
<DetailID>1</DetailID>
<DetailName>sample string 2</DetailName>
<IsRequired>true</IsRequired>
<IsSupplier>true</IsSupplier>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el.CreateZoneCheckListDetailListModel>
</DetailList>
<SubJobTypeID>1</SubJobTypeID>
<SubJobTypeName>sample string 2</SubJobTypeName>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el.CreateZoneCheckListSubJobTypeListModel>
</SubJobTypeList>
<ZoneTypeID>3</ZoneTypeID>
</ImportZoneCheckListRequest.CreateZoneCheckListJobTypeListModel>
</JobTypeList>
<ProjectList>
<ImportZoneCheckListRequest.CreateZoneCheckListProjectListModel>
<ProjectCode>sample string 1</ProjectCode>
<Selected>sample string 2</Selected>
</ImportZoneCheckListRequest.CreateZoneCheckListProjectListModel>
<ImportZoneCheckListRequest.CreateZoneCheckListProjectListModel>
<ProjectCode>sample string 1</ProjectCode>
<Selected>sample string 2</Selected>
</ImportZoneCheckListRequest.CreateZoneCheckListProjectListModel>
</ProjectList>
<ProjectTypeID>sample string 4</ProjectTypeID>
<Status>sample string 5</Status>
<UserEmail>sample string 1</UserEmail>
</ImportZoneCheckListRequest>
application/x-www-form-urlencoded
Sample:
Response Information
Resource Description
IHttpActionResultNone.
Response Formats
application/json, text/json, application/xml, text/xml
Sample:
Sample not available.